"First, this intake is for LATE '02 thru '05.5 B6 a4's.
My A4 was an early '02 so it required a bit of modification for proper fitment and function.
The use of the factory lower air box and air duct maintains "cold air" supply and helps retain a clean look in the engine compartment. The large composite intake pipe W/mass air fitting and large filter really help improve air flow. Installation is not very easy for the average diy'er. But can be done in about 1 to 2 hrs (early '02 needs add. parts). Effect: bit louder engine, Diverter valve can be heard. Smoother torque and throttle (seat of pants) Con: audible "whislte" around 2k @ light throttle. Overall: challenging install. Great results, great price."

"Purchase: I bought this intake because in summer weather, the Ridgeline needs a little extra power, and because it has a cover over the top, which I thought might prevent water from entering the intake (It's open on the back side). Also, it was the least expensive. The shipping was free, it took about a week (surprisingly, it took several days to "fill" the order and for me to get a UPS tracking number).
Installation: The directions were barely adequate, leaving out some little steps such as adding lock washers to the bolts, but with only three pieces to work with, I got it done in about an hour. The box sits right up against the metal fender, and the shape is a few millimeters off, so I had to force it a little, which scraped the inside of the fender (no will will see, its behind the air box).
Performance: It sounds good, its barely any louder under normal diving, but really gets loud under full throttle, and loudest when the VTEC kicks in at about 4000 rpm."

"This intake was labeled 1997-2005 Wrangler TJ, but I purchased it anyway figuring on a misprint. Nope. Not a misprint. The air dam needed a slight modification to widen the opening for the AC line, and I gently bent the footing to align it with the factory mounts. Those mods took maybe ten minutes, then everything fit perfectly. The additional performance increase was immediate! I drove up the winding highway to Cripple Creek shortly afterward (over 10,000ft before dropping into the town), and the engine performed amazingly, in 5th and 6th gears nearly all the time, and never lower than 4th for the climb. My gas mileage has improved by 2-3mpg as well. Awesome!"
